Which two elements would NOT be capable of forming an ionic
bond?

a phosphorus and chlorine
b barium and nitrogen
c iodine and sodium
d. calcium and oxyge​n

Answer:

a phosphorus and chlorine

Explanation:

Phosphorus and chlorine are the two groups of elements that would not be capable of forming an ionic bond.

Ionic bonds occurs between a metal and a non-metal to produce an electrovalent compound.

  • Bonds between non-metals are covalent bonds.
  • Bonds between metals are metallic bonds.

Phosphorus and chlorine are non-metals.

  • To form an ionic bond, an electropositive metal loses electrons.
  • They become positively charged in the process.
  • The non-metal which is highly electronegative gains the electrons and becomes negatively charged.
  • The electrostatic attraction resulting from the two oppositely charged species produces the ionic bonding.

This is not possible with phosphorus and chlorine.
